  24. Excellent post but just need to point out that the current Prime Minister Lawrence Wong is not related to the Lee family. Also between 1990 to 2004, the Prime Minister was Goh Chok Tong and not related to the Lee's family. The Lee dynasty has practically ended after Lee Hsien Loong, son of Lee Kuan Yew stepped down. There are currently none in the Lee family in active politics.
